ID:33329
O. B. from Gloucestershire
Friday 21 July 2017 (8 years ago)
Area:Upper Wye
Beat:Llangoed & Lower Llanstephan
Fishing:Salmon
No. of Anglers:1
1 x coloured cock salmon, 28 inches, from Chapel Catch on size 12 Black Pennell fished on the dropper. Again fishing small flies with a switch rod. We wanted rain and boy did we get it this afternoon. It was really pouring, but there came that magic half hour with the level lifted by a few inches, but before the river coloured, which brought a few residents on to the take.
1 Salmon

ID:33357
T. E. from Bracknell
Friday 21 July 2017 (8 years ago)
Area:Lower Wye
Beat:Courtfield
Fishing:Coarse
No. of Anglers:2
Fished roving all around the meadow swims. Tactics included float, feeder and float paternoster. We fished the morning and early afternoon but heavy rain meant we took a break until the evening. Fish caught were lots of dace and chub and minnows, and one lost pike of around 10lb. The evening session after the rain included 3 barbel of 6lb,and 7.5lb to T Everitt and a cracking 10lb barbel to A Davis. All fish were in superb condition. We enjoyed this session very much.
3 Barbel, 4 Chub, 10 Other
